What are the 12 steps of Alcoholics Anonymous?

The "Twelve Steps" are the cornerstone of the AA program for personal recovery from alcoholism. They are not theoretical abstractions; they are based on the trial and error experiences of early AA members. These steps outline attitudes and activities that were crucial in helping them achieve sobriety.

These Twelve Steps serve as a roadmap for individuals seeking to overcome their addiction to alcohol. They provide a practical guide to self-reflection, accountability, and personal growth. By following these steps, individuals can develop the necessary tools and mindset to maintain long-term sobriety and find a sense of peace and fulfillment in their lives.

Paragraph 1: The 12 Steps of Alcoholics Anonymous were invented by William Griffith Wilson and Dr. Bob Smith in Akron, Ohio, in 1935. This groundbreaking program, also known as AA, was the first of its kind and aimed to help individuals struggling with alcohol addiction. Wilson and Smith, affectionately known as "Bill W" and "Dr. Bob" by AA members, created a set of principles and guidelines that have since become widely used in addiction recovery.

Paragraph 2: The history of the 12 Steps of Alcoholics Anonymous is rooted in the founding of the organization itself. In 1935, Bill W and Dr. Bob recognized the need for a structured approach to overcoming alcohol addiction. Drawing from their own personal experiences and struggles with alcoholism, they developed a program that emphasized personal reflection, acceptance of powerlessness, and reliance on a higher power. The 12 Steps were designed to provide individuals with a roadmap to recovery and a supportive community of fellow alcoholics.

What is the amount of time it takes to work through the 12 steps?

How long does it take to work the 12 steps? The average time it takes for someone to complete the 12 steps can vary. Many 12-step sponsors encourage sponsees and newcomers to AA and other 12-step programs to attend 90 meetings in 90 days, or at least one meeting a day for three months.
